Whether you want to light a new love’s flame or simply head on a romantic retreat, there’s no better place to do it than the Caribbean, where every sunrise brings the promise of secluded sands for two. And while there’s nothing wrong with checking into a sprawling property, we’re partial to smaller places, those intimate places to stay where we receive a hotel-style welcome and service, yet somehow still feel as if we have the whole place to ourselves. These tiny romantic hotels, none exceeding 13 rooms, are some of the most romantic places in the region.

Secret Bay, Dominica A Dominica vacation doesn’t get any more romantic than a getaway to these eight eco-luxe villas, which boast outdoor showers; private plunge pools; and dedicated butlers who’ll focus on your needs (while you focus on each other’s). (It’s also our favorite of all Dominica resorts).
